Shop by Model Family

TrailMaster Electrical Systems Are Not Universal

Use the model hub and parts breakdown to identify the machine before comparing plugs. The number printed on the engine is not the go-kart model.

Youth Platform

Mini XRS, XRX and XRX-R

The XRS is pull start and does not use the wireless remote. Electric-start XRX and XRX-R models use batteries, starters and remote shutoff systems. Standard and Plus versions can share some parts, but brakes, frame pieces and other components changed.

Mid-Size Platform

Mid XRS, XRX, XRX-R and Blazer 200R

Mid XRS is pull start. XRX and XRX-R use electric start with push controls. Blazer 200R uses the same Mid-size mechanical platform but has a keyed starting system and model-specific harness and body wiring.

Full-Size Platform

150, 200, 200E and Full-Size Blazer

Carbureted 150 and 200 machines use different engine and fuel-system wiring from EFI-equipped 200E models. Full-size karts use a brake-pedal safety switch in the starting circuit. Confirm XRS, XRX, carburetor or EFI before ordering.

Starting Circuit Basics

What Happens When You Press Start or Turn the Key?

Understanding the order of the circuit keeps owners from replacing expensive parts at random. The exact safety switches vary by model, but electric-start systems follow the same basic path.

1. Battery supplies power
The battery must provide sufficient voltage under starter load, not only a normal resting reading.
2. Fuse protects the circuit
A blown fuse can make the entire machine appear dead. Inspect it before buying switches or a starter.
3. Controls request start
The key or push button sends the starting command through any required safety circuit.
4. Solenoid closes
The starter solenoid uses the low-current command to connect battery power to the starter motor.
5. Starter turns engine
The starter motor cranks the engine while ignition and fuel systems create combustion.

Diagnose Before Replacing

Electrical Symptom Guide

Symptom Check First Do Not Assume
Nothing happens at all Battery connections, main fuse, ground cable, key or stop switch and safety-switch position A silent machine does not automatically need a starter motor.
Single click but no crank Battery under load, battery cables, ground, solenoid terminals and starter connection A click can occur with a weak battery or poor cable connection.
Cranks slowly Battery charge, cable tightness, corrosion, ground and starter load A resting voltage number alone cannot prove that the battery is healthy.
Cranks but will not run Fuel valves, choke, kill switch, ignition spark, brake switch where required and EFI pump prime The starter circuit is working if it cranks; diagnose fuel and ignition next.
Battery repeatedly goes dead Battery condition, maintainer use, loose wires, switches left on, charging output and unwanted electrical draw TrailMaster charging systems are small; brief rides may not replace repeated starting energy.
Fuse blows repeatedly Pinched wires, rubbed insulation, reversed cables, water, incorrect accessories and damaged connectors Do not install a larger fuse to hide a short circuit.
Lights or accessories fail Bulb or lamp, switch, connector, local ground, fuse and harness branch An accessory problem does not necessarily mean the main harness has failed.

GoKartMasters Field Note

Check the Fuse Before Taking the Kart Apart

On many Mini and Mid electric-start karts, a bundle of wires is collected behind the passenger seat with a hook-and-loop strap. Look for a red wire with a white cylindrical fuse case. Open the case to inspect the fuse; many include a spare fuse in the holder.

Replace with the correct ratingUse the specified fuse. A larger fuse can allow wiring damage instead of protecting the circuit.
Find the causeIf the replacement blows again, inspect for a short, crushed wire, reversed battery cable or damaged accessory connection.
Carry a spareA fuse is one of the easiest trail-side repairs. Keep the correct spare with the machine and your basic metric tools.

Battery and Charging

Protect the Electrical System With a Maintained Battery

Keep electric-start machines on an automatic 12V battery maintainer whenever they are parked. Avoid high-amperage automotive chargers and avoid jump-starting from a running vehicle. Low voltage can imitate failed switches, solenoids, starters and EFI components.

TrailMaster Electrical Parts FAQs

Why does my TrailMaster click but not crank?

Begin with battery condition under load, cable tightness, engine and frame grounds, solenoid connections and the starter cable. A click does not prove that the solenoid or starter has failed.

Why will a 150, 200 or 300 crank only when I press the brake?

The brake pedal operates a starter safety switch on these full-size platforms. If the machine will not crank, verify neutral, press the brake firmly and inspect brake-switch operation before replacing the starter.

Are TrailMaster wiring harnesses interchangeable?

No. Harnesses vary by model, starting controls, lights, fuel system and production version. Match the OEM number and every connector instead of ordering by appearance.

Can I bypass a safety switch?

GoKartMasters does not recommend bypassing factory safety switches. Diagnose the switch, adjustment, connector and wiring, then replace the correct part when needed.

Can I jump-start the kart from a car?

Avoid using a vehicle battery, especially with the vehicle running. Charge and maintain the small powersports battery with an appropriate automatic 12V charger or use a suitable portable jump pack cautiously.
